BUILD SOURCE CODE LICENSE TERMS: 06/20/2000 |
[1] I give you permission to make modifications to my Build source and |
distribute it, BUT: |
[2] Any derivative works based on my Build source may be distributed ONLY |
through the INTERNET. |
[3] Distribution of any derivative works MUST be done completely FREE of |
charge - no commercial exploitation whatsoever. |
[4] Anything you distribute which uses a part of my Build Engine source |
code MUST include: |
[A] The following message somewhere in the archive: |
// "Build Engine & Tools" Copyright (c) 1993-1997 Ken Silverman |
// Ken Silverman's official web site: "http://www.advsys.net/ken" |
// See the included license file "BUILDLIC.TXT" for license info. |
[B] This text file "BUILDLIC.TXT" along with it. |
[C] Any source files that you modify must include this message as well: |
// This file has been modified from Ken Silverman's original release |
[5] The use of the Build Engine for commercial purposes will require an |
appropriate license arrangement with me. Contact information is |
on my web site. |
[6] I take no responsibility for damage to your system. |
[7] Technical support: Before contacting me with questions, please read |
and do ALL of the following! |
[A] Look through ALL of my text files. There are 7 of them (including this |
one). I like to think that I wrote them for a reason. You will find |
many of your answers in the history section of BUILD.TXT and |
BUILD2.TXT (they're located inside SRC.ZIP). |
[B] If that doesn't satisfy you, then try going to: |
"http://www.advsys.net/ken/buildsrc" |
where I will maintain a Build Source Code FAQ (or perhaps I might |
just provide a link to a good FAQ). |
[C] I am willing to respond to questions, but ONLY if they come at a rate |
that I can handle. |
PLEASE TRY TO AVOID ASKING DUPLICATE QUESTIONS! |
As my line of defense, I will post my current policy about |
answering Build source questions (right below the E-mail address |
on my web site.) You can check there to see if I'm getting |
overloaded with questions or not. |
If I'm too busy, it might say something like this: |
I'm too busy to answer Build source questions right now. |
Sorry, but don't expect a reply from me any time soon. |
If I'm open for Build source questions, please state your question |
clearly and don't include any unsolicited attachments unless |
they're really small (like less than 50k). Assume that I have |
a 28.8k modem. Also, don't leave out important details just |
to make your question appear shorter - making me guess what |
you're asking doesn't save me time! |
---------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
-Ken S. (official web site: http://www.advsys.net/ken) |

; Script generated by the HM NIS Edit Script Wizard. |
; HM NIS Edit Wizard helper defines |
!define PRODUCT_NAME "Duke Nukem 3D HRP" |
!define PRODUCT_VERSION "V 4.0 (321)" |
!define PRODUCT_WEB_SITE "http://hrp.duke4.net" |
!define PRODUCT_DIR_REGKEY "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\App Paths\eduke32.exe" |
!define PRODUCT_UNINST_KEY "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Uninstall\${PRODUCT_NAME}" |
!define PRODUCT_UNINST_ROOT_KEY "HKLM" |
!define PRODUCT_STARTMENU_REGVAL "NSIS:StartMenuDir" |
SetCompressor lzma |
; MUI 1.67 compatible ------ |
!include "MUI.nsh" |
!include "Sections.nsh" |
; MUI Settings |
!define MUI_ABORTWARNING |
!define MUI_ICON "icon.ico" |
!define MUI_UNICON "uninst.ico" |
!define MUI_HEADERIMAGE |
!define MUI_WELCOMEFINISHPAGE_BITMAP "page.bmp" |
!insertmacro MUI_DEFAULT MUI_HEADERIMAGE_BITMAP "banner.bmp" |
; Welcome page |
!define MUI_WELCOMEPAGE_TITLE_3LINES |
!insertmacro MUI_PAGE_WELCOME |
; License page (Build license) |
!define MUI_PAGE_HEADER_TEXT "Build Source Code License Agreement (Build engine)" |
!define MUI_PAGE_HEADER_SUBTEXT "Please review the license terms of the build source code before installing." |
!insertmacro MUI_PAGE_LICENSE "BUILDLIC.TXT" |
; License page (GNU public license) |
!define MUI_PAGE_HEADER_TEXT "GNU Public License Agreement (EDuke32)" |
!define MUI_PAGE_HEADER_SUBTEXT "Please review the license terms of the EDuke32 port before installing." |
!insertmacro MUI_PAGE_LICENSE "GNU.TXT" |
; License page (HRP art license) |
!define MUI_PAGE_HEADER_TEXT "HRP Art License Agreement (High Resolution Content)" |
!define MUI_PAGE_HEADER_SUBTEXT "Please review the license terms of the high resolution content port before installing." |
!insertmacro MUI_PAGE_LICENSE "hrp_art_license.txt" |
; Components page |
!insertmacro MUI_PAGE_COMPONENTS |
; Directory page |
!insertmacro MUI_PAGE_DIRECTORY |
; Start menu page |
var ICONS_GROUP |
!define MUI_STARTMENUPAGE_NODISABLE |
!define MUI_STARTMENUPAGE_DEFAULTFOLDER "Duke Nukem 3D" |
!define MUI_STARTMENUPAGE_REGISTRY_ROOT "${PRODUCT_UNINST_ROOT_KEY}" |
!define MUI_STARTMENUPAGE_REGISTRY_KEY "${PRODUCT_UNINST_KEY}" |
!define MUI_STARTMENUPAGE_REGISTRY_VALUENAME "${PRODUCT_STARTMENU_REGVAL}" |
!insertmacro MUI_PAGE_STARTMENU Application $ICONS_GROUP |
; Instfiles page |
!insertmacro MUI_PAGE_INSTFILES |
; Finish page |
!define MUI_FINISHPAGE_RUN "$INSTDIR\eduke32.exe" |
!define MUI_FINISHPAGE_RUN_PARAMETERS "" |
!define MUI_FINISHPAGE_LINK "Visit the HRP website." |
!define MUI_FINISHPAGE_LINK_LOCATION "http://hrp.duke4.net" |
!define MUI_FINISHPAGE_SHOWREADME "$INSTDIR\hrp_readme.txt" |
!insertmacro MUI_PAGE_FINISH |
; Uninstaller pages |
!insertmacro MUI_UNPAGE_INSTFILES |
; Language files |
!insertmacro MUI_LANGUAGE "English" |
; Reserve files |
!insertmacro MUI_RESERVEFILE_INSTALLOPTIONS |
; MUI end ------ |
Name "${PRODUCT_NAME} ${PRODUCT_VERSION}" |
OutFile "dn3d_hrp-4.0(321).exe" |
InstallDir "c:\duke3d" |
InstallDirRegKey HKLM "${PRODUCT_DIR_REGKEY}" "" |
ShowInstDetails show |
ShowUnInstDetails show |
Section "EDuke32" SEC01 |
SetOutPath "$INSTDIR" |
SetOverwrite ifnewer |
File "eduke32\eduke32.exe" |
File "eduke32\mapster32.exe" |
File "eduke32\m32help.hlp" |
File "eduke32\NAMES.H" |
File "eduke32\tiles.cfg" |
; Shortcuts |
!insertmacro MUI_STARTMENU_WRITE_BEGIN Application |
CreateDirectory "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P" |
CreateShortCut "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Duke Nukem 3D (EDuke32).lnk" "$INSTDIR\eduke32.exe" |
CreateShortCut "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Mapster32.lnk" "$INSTDIR\eduke32.exe" |
!insertmacro MUI_STARTMENU_WRITE_END |
SectionEnd |
Section "High resolution content" SEC02 |
SetOutPath "$INSTDIR" |
SetOverwrite ifnewer |
File "hrp_content\hrp_readme.txt" |
File "hrp_content\hrp_art_license.txt" |
SetOutPath "$INSTDIR\autoload" |
File "hrp_content\duke3d_hrp.zip" |
SectionEnd |
Section "High Quality Muisc" SEC05 |
SetOutPath "$instdir\autoload" |
SetOverwrite ifnewer |
File "music\eduke32_mus.zip" |
SectionEnd |
Section "Duke Plus mod" SEC06 |
SetOutPath "$INSTDIR" |
SetOverwrite ifnewer |
File "duke_plus\DPEFFECTS.html" |
File "duke_plus\dukeplus.bat"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us_Manual.html" |
File "duke_plus\mapster.bat" |
SetOutPath "$INSTDIR\DukePlus"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\dpmaps.zip"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\dukeplus.def"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\DUKEPLUS_RESOURCES.zip"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\EDUKE.CON"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\tiles005.art"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\tiles024.art" |
SetOutPath "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\dpcons"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\dpcons\DEFSPLUS.CON"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\dpcons\DUKEPLUS.CON"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\dpcons\HUDPLUS.CON"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\dpcons\LIGHTS.CON"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\dpcons\PLAYERPLUS.CON" |
File "duke_plus\DukePlus\dpcons\USERPLUS.CON" |
; Shortcuts |
!insertmacro MUI_STARTMENU_WRITE_BEGIN Application |
CreateDirectory "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P" |
SetOutPath "$INSTDIR" |
CreateShortCut "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Duke Plus.lnk" "$INSTDIR\dukeplus.bat" |
!insertmacro MUI_STARTMENU_WRITE_END |
SectionEnd |
Section "-grpinstaller" |
SetOutPath "$INSTDIR" |
SetOverwrite ifnewer |
File "datainst.exe" |
IfFileExists "$INSTDIR\duke3d.grp" SkipGrpIn |
MessageBox MB_YESNO "Do you want to run the GRP installer to find your duke3d.grp file and copy it to your HRP folder?" IDNO SkipGrpIn |
DetailPrint "Running grp installer..." |
exec "$INSTDIR\datainst.exe" |
SkipGrpIn: |
SectionEnd |
Function .onSelChange |
!insertmacro StartRadioButtons $1 |
!insertmacro RadioButton ${SEC03} |
!insertmacro RadioButton ${SEC04} |
!insertmacro EndRadioButtons |
FunctionEnd |
Function .onInit |
System::Call 'kernel32::CreateMutexA(i 0, i 0, t "${PRODUCT_NAME} ${PRODUCT_VERSION}") i .r1 ?e' |
Pop $R0 |
StrCmp $R0 0 +3 |
MessageBox MB_OK|MB_ICONEXCLAMATION "The installer is already running." |
Abort |
SetOutPath $TEMP |
File /oname=spltmp.bmp "hrp_splash.bmp" |
advsplash::show 1500 600 250 -1 $TEMP\spltmp |
Pop $0 |
Delete $TEMP\spltmp.bmp |
StrCpy $1 ${SEC04} ; Group 1 - Option 1 is selected by default |
FunctionEnd |
Section -AdditionalIcons |
!insertmacro MUI_STARTMENU_WRITE_BEGIN Application |
WriteIniStr "$INSTDIR\${PRODUCT_NAME}.url" "InternetShortcut" "URL" "${PRODUCT_WEB_SITE}" |
CreateShortCut "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\HRP Website.lnk" "$INSTDIR\${PRODUCT_NAME}.url" |
CreateShortCut "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Uninstall.lnk" "$INSTDIR\uninst.exe" |
!insertmacro MUI_STARTMENU_WRITE_END |
SectionEnd |
Section -Post |
WriteUninstaller "$INSTDIR\uninst.exe" |
WriteRegStr HKLM "${PRODUCT_DIR_REGKEY}" "" "$INSTDIR\eduke32.exe" |
WriteRegStr HKLM "${PRODUCT_DIR_REGKEY}" "Path" "$INSTDIR" |
WriteRegStr ${PRODUCT_UNINST_ROOT_KEY} "${PRODUCT_UNINST_KEY}" "DisplayName" "$(^Name)" |
WriteRegStr ${PRODUCT_UNINST_ROOT_KEY} "${PRODUCT_UNINST_KEY}" "UninstallString" "$INSTDIR\uninst.exe" |
WriteRegStr ${PRODUCT_UNINST_ROOT_KEY} "${PRODUCT_UNINST_KEY}" "DisplayVersion" "${PRODUCT_VERSION}" |
WriteRegStr ${PRODUCT_UNINST_ROOT_KEY} "${PRODUCT_UNINST_KEY}" "URLInfoAbout" "${PRODUCT_WEB_SITE}" |
SectionEnd |
; Section descriptions |
!insertmacro MUI_FUNCTION_DESCRIPTION_BEGIN |
!insertmacro MUI_DESCRIPTION_TEXT ${SEC01} "The eDuke32 port that is needed to use the high resolution content. Only uncheck this if you want to install it manualy or if you already have it installed." |
!insertmacro MUI_DESCRIPTION_TEXT ${SEC02} "The high resoltution textures and models." |
!insertmacro MUI_DESCRIPTION_TEXT ${SEC03} "Map hacks for atomic and plutonium pack version of the game. fixes model related problems caused by original level design not being designed for 3D models." |
!insertmacro MUI_DESCRIPTION_TEXT ${SEC04} "Map hacks for 1.3d full or shareware version of the game. fixes model related problems caused by original level design not being designed for 3D models." |
!insertmacro MUI_DESCRIPTION_TEXT ${SEC05} "A pack of high quality replacements for the games music." |
!insertmacro MUI_DESCRIPTION_TEXT ${SEC06} "A game enhancement mod with bug fixes and (mostly optional) new features." |
!insertmacro MUI_FUNCTION_DESCRIPTION_END |
Function un.onUninstSuccess |
HideWindow |
MessageBox MB_ICONINFORMATION|MB_OK "$(^Name) was successfully removed from your computer." |
FunctionEnd |
Function un.onInit |
MessageBox MB_ICONQUESTION|MB_YESNO|MB_DEFBUTTON2 "Are you sure you want to completely remove $(^Name) and all of its components?" IDYES +2 |
Abort |
FunctionEnd |
Section Uninstall |
!insertmacro MUI_STARTMENU_GETFOLDER "Application" $ICONS_GROUP |
Delete "$INSTDIR\${PRODUCT_NAME}.url"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\uninst.exe" |
;eduke32 files |
Delete "$INSTDIR\eduke32.exe"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\mapster32.exe"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\m32help.hlp"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\NAMES.H"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\tiles.cfg" |
;hrp content |
Delete "$INSTDIR\hrp_readme.txt"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\hrp_art_license.txt"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\autoload\duke3d_hrp.zip" |
;music content |
Delete "$INSTDIR\autoload\eduke32_mus.zip" |
;duke plus |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DPEFFECTS.html"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\dukeplus.bat"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us_Manual.html"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\mapster.bat"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\dpmaps.zip"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\dukeplus.def"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\DUKEPLUS_RESOURCES.zip"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\EDUKE.CON"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\tiles005.art"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\tiles024.art"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\dpcons\DEFSPLUS.CON"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\dpcons\DUKEPLUS.CON"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\dpcons\HUDPLUS.CON"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\dpcons\LIGHTS.CON"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\dpcons\PLAYERPLUS.CON"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\dpcons\USERPLUS.CON"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\*.log" |
IfFileExists "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\*.cfg" 0 SkipDnPlusCfg |
MessageBox MB_YESNO "Do you want to remove Duke Plus configuration files? These files contain the configuration of the Duke Plus mod." IDNO SkipDnPlusCfg |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\*.cfg" |
SkipDnPlusCfg: |
IfFileExists "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\*.sav" 0 SkipDnPlusSav |
MessageBox MB_YESNO "Do you want to remove your saved Duke Plus games?" IDNO SkipDnPlusSav |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\*.sav" |
SkipDnPlusSav: |
IfFileExists "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\*.dmo" 0 SkipDnPlusDmo |
MessageBox MB_YESNO "Do you want to remove your Duke Plus demo recordings?" IDNO SkipDnPlusDmo |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\*.dmo" |
SkipDnPlusDmo: |
;datainst |
Delete "$INSTDIR\datainst.exe" |
;cahce files |
Delete "$INSTDIR\textures"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\*.cache"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\textures" |
Delete "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\*.cache" |
; shortcuts |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Uninstall"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\HRP Website"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Duke Nukem 3D (EDuke32)"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Mapster32"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Duke Plus"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Setup video audio and controls"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Uninstall.lnk"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\HRP Website.lnk"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Duke Nuke.lnkm 3D (EDuke32).lnk"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Mapster32"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Duke Plus.lnk" |
Delete "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P\Setup video audio and controls.lnk" |
;logfiles |
Delete "$INSTDIR\*.log" |
;folders |
SetOutPath $TEMP |
RMDir "$SMPROGRAMS\$ICONS_GROUP" |
RMDir "$INSTDIR\autoload" |
RMDir "$INSTDIR\autoload" |
RMDir "$INSTDIR\texcache" |
RMDir "$INSTDIR\DukePlus\dpcons" |
RMDir "$INSTDIR\DukePlus" |
RMDir "$INSTDIR" |
IfFileExists "$INSTDIR\duke3d.grp" 0 SkipGrpUn |
MessageBox MB_YESNO "Do you want to remove $INSTDIR\duke3d.grp? This file contains the original Duke Nukem 3D art, maps, sounds etc." IDNO SkipGrpUn |
Delete "$INSTDIR\duke3d.grp" |
SkipGrpUn: |
IfFileExists "$INSTDIR\*.cfg" 0 SkipCfgUn |
MessageBox MB_YESNO "Do you want to remove eDuke32 configuration files? These files contain the configuration of eDuke32 and Mapster32." IDNO SkipCfgUn |
Delete "$INSTDIR\duke3d.cfg" |
SkipCfgUn: |
IfFileExists "$INSTDIR\*.sav" 0 SkipSavUn |
MessageBox MB_YESNO "Do you want to remove your saved games?" IDNO SkipSavUn |
Delete "$INSTDIR\*.sav" |
SkipSavUn: |
IfFileExists "$INSTDIR\*.dmo" 0 SkipDmoUn |
MessageBox MB_YESNO "Do you want to remove your demo recordings?" IDNO SkipDmoUn |
Delete "$INSTDIR\*.dmo" |
SkipDmoUn: |
DeleteRegKey ${PRODUCT_UNINST_ROOT_KEY} "${PRODUCT_UNINST_KEY}" |
DeleteRegKey HKLM "${PRODUCT_DIR_REGKEY}" |
SetAutoClose true |
SectionEnd |

1) ABOUT |
======== |
Remember "Duke Nukem 3D", the great first-person shooter 3D Realms released |
back in 1996? Its cool protagonist, ingame atmosphere, original weaponry and |
many other features make it worth playing even today. |
For all Duke fans who want to play the game again in a modern Windows / Linux |
environment with 3D accelerated graphics, the Duke3D community has created the |
High Resolution Pack (HRP). Utilizing the amazing skills of various texturing |
and modelling artists, the project's goal is to replace all textures and |
sprites with high-res versions, optimizing it for latest OpenGL ports. |
All you need is the "duke3d.grp" file from your original Duke3D v1.3d or |
Atomic (v1.5) CD-ROM. You can also play with the shareware version available |
over at http://www.3drealms.com/downloads.html . |
What the Duke Nukem 3D HRP has to offer: |
- EDuke32 port for Duke Nukem 3D (by TerminX and Plagman, based on JFDuke3D |
by Jonathon "JonoF" Fowler). Supports older Polymost renderer as well as |
the more advanced Polymer renderer (with advanced effects like |
normal/specular mapping, per-pixel dynamic lighting, real-time shadows,etc) |
For more info about these ports, check out JonoF's JFDuke3D and the |
EDuke32 site. |
- 32-bit high resolution textures with 4-8 times the detail of the original |
textures. |
- Models instead of the old sprites. |
While the HRP is still "work in progress" and missing quite a few textures and |
models, you can check the Duke4.net forums at http://forums.duke4.net for |
additional content or even better contributing something of your own. |
The community's goal is to issue a new HRP version once in 1-2 year(s). |
=============== |
2) INSTALLATION |
=============== |
Installing is easy: |
First make sure you have your Duke3D CD in your CD/DVD drive or an existing |
installation of the game. You can also just have the "duke3d.grp" file |
somewhere on your system. |
Then run the self-extracting archive (the file you downloaded/got from a friend |
or whatever) by double-clicking it. Then just choose any hard drive/subdir of |
your personal preference. |
After the extraction process is complete, you may copy over any existing |
"duke3d.grp" file you already have (either directly from the installation disc |
or from the folder which contains your digital copy). Be sure to overwrite the |
existing "duke3d.grp" since this one only contains the shareware episode. |
After you are done, start the game by clicking "eduke32.exe" in the Duke3D |
folder. |
You can also create a shortcut by right-clicking the file and choose |
"Send to" --> "Desktop (Create shortcut)". |
IMPORTANT: |
In order to see the high resolution textures and models, you have to change the |
render mode to 32-bit Polymer in the "Video Settings" under "Options" in the |
game menu. |
Otherwise, HRP content will not work (properly)! |
POLYMOST COMPATIBILITY OPTION: |
For players who are unable to use the advanced Polymer renderer (e.g. because |
they experience graphics issues or their graphics card simply can't handle it), |
please deactivate (= untick) the "Polymer" checkbox in the EDuke32 launcher and |
run the game with this parameter: -hduke3d_hrp_polymost.def |
> Example: E:\Duke3D\eduke32.exe -hduke3d_hrp_polymost.def |
Alternatively, and if you want to run mods like DukePlus, using the |
Polymost Override Pack (put into the autoload folder) is the recommended way of |
running the Polymost HRP mode. A matching version of this pack should be |
available soon after any HRP release at: |
http://forums.duke4.net/index.php?showtopic=3513 |
======== |
3) NOTES |
======== |
---------------- |
3.1) WIP Release |
---------------- |
Since this is a work in progress version of the pack which has not been tested |
extensively, there are probably some issues that need fixing. Please let us |
know of any problems with it so they can be sorted out in future versions. Also |
notify us if we are missing any art that's been released prior to the pack's |
release date, even though we have skipped some stuff since we simply did not |
like it, there is maybe some stuff that has been missed to include. |
Please also be aware of the fact that we are still missing models and textures |
because these have not been remade yet by the community. They will probably |
be featured in upcoming releases of the HRP (or updates). |
For a full summary of what's left to do, you may have a look at the HRP Wiki |
todo-list: http://hrp.duke4.net/wiki/doku.php?id=other:next_hrp_release |
------------------------------- |
3.2) Highlights of this Release |
------------------------------- |
Compared to previous release (HRP v5.2), you can expect the following changes: |
[FEATURE] New maphacks system: Hacks for 500+ custom maps included! |
[UPDATE] Polymer versions of 15 existing textures added; about 10 new textures |
(some for Ep.4) |
[UPDATE] Remakes of existing props models: |
Airlock sign, microphone, exit sign, hand dryer, Terminator+arm, |
Cycloid Emperor hologram, Dukeburger statue |
[UPDATE] Remakes of character models for Cycloid Emperor (by Tea Monster) and |
Duke (by Mark Skelton, Tea Monster and Spiker) |
[UPDATE] Remakes of pickup models: Jetpack, health bottles, First Aid kit |
[UPDATE] Improvements for Mighty Boot, HUD pistol hands and chaingun muzzleflash |
[UPDATE] New level stats screen (based on new Duke model) |
[FIX] Screen alignment fix for HUD scubagear |
[FIX] Small corrections for pistol and shotgun pickup models (size, rotation, |
center) |
IMPORTANT! |
---------- |
Please note that all HRP v5.x contents have been optimized for usage with the |
Polymer renderer. This means that if you use the older Polymost renderer, |
you WILL encounter problems (HUD weapons rendered incorrectly, or other display |
glitches). Polymer requirements offer advanced graphics effects but demand much |
better hardware. |
If you are forced to use Polymost due to having a weaker machine, be sure to |
launch the HRP in Polymost mode (see "Installation" section for more info)! |
----------------- |
3.3) Known issues |
----------------- |
Although we've tried hard to eliminate or avoid any glitches, unfortunately |
some of them could not be removed in this release. Here are those we know of: |
- Current EDuke32 problems (might get fixed in future versions): |
> The startup screens are not optimized for widescreen resolutions and |
might show black stripes on both sides and possibly some distortions, |
depending on your display. |
> EDuke32 (current version is r4791) does not make use of the HRP's |
maphack file hierarchy yet. Therefore, the UserMapHacks pack needs to |
be downloaded to make use of the already existing user map maphacks. |
- Rarely you will still find props, pickup weapons or the like that are |
clipping into walls, often preventing you from seeing them completely. |
Maphacks can fix these glitches, so don't hesitate to report anything you |
consider worthy of correcting. |
- Slime babe #1323 has a transparency/clipping bug with her hair. Updating |
the model should solve that problem. |
- If you use OpenGL texture compression/disk caching in EDuke32, the skyboxes |
will lose detail, i.e. look more pixellated than intended. This can be |
especially noticed with L.A. Night skybox (as seen in E1L1) when looking at |
the clouds. Right now, your only choice to fix this is to deactivate texture |
compression in the menu. Note that this will also deactivate disk caching, so |
you will have to deal with increased level loading times and possibly jerky |
framerates in some situations. |
--------------------- |
3.4) Title Screen Art |
--------------------- |
The front screen is a slightly modified and enhanced version of 3D Realms' |
original art work used with permission. |
----------------- |
3.5) EDuke32 Port |
----------------- |
The EDuke32 port is an enhanced version of JonoF's initial JFDuke3D port and |
features enhanced mod support together with tons of newly-added code. It is |
released and maintained by TerminX. |
We are using EDuke32 for running HRP now because the port gets updated |
frequently, and it offers advanced features for which HRP contents has been |
optimized. |
=========== |
4) LICENSES |
=========== |
-------- |
4.1) HRP |
-------- |
The contents of the High Resolution Pack are licensed under these three |
licenses: |
- The build engine is licensed under Ken Silverman's Build License which can be |
found in "BUILDLIC.TXT". |
- The EDuke32 port is licensed under the GNU Public license which can be found |
in "GNU.TXT". |
- The art content is licensed under the High Resolution Pack Art License which |
can be found in "hrp_art_license.txt". |
----------- |
4.2) Others |
----------- |
Some textures in this pack are based on source textures copyrighted by |
CGTextures.com. Permission to use and distribute these specific textures has |
been granted to the author(s) of this texture pack. Textures downloaded from |
CGTextures.com are copyrighted and may NOT be redistributed or sold. For |
more information and the full license, please visit http://www.cgtextures.com. |
This disclaimer applies to the following textures: |
- highres\sprites\props: 585 |
- highres\sprites\signs: 4420, 4949, 4955 |
- highres\textures: 1120 |
